Best Cultural Centers to Visit in Zanzibar

Zanzibar, the Spice Island of Tanzania, is not only famous for its pristine beaches and turquoise waters but also for its rich cultural heritage. From Swahili architecture and Arab influences to African traditions and colonial history, Zanzibar offers travelers an authentic insight into its vibrant past and living culture. Visiting the island’s cultural centers is one of the best ways to understand its history, arts, and traditions, making your trip both enriching and memorable.

1. The Palace Museum (Beit-el-Sahel)

  • Why Visit: Once the home of Zanzibar’s sultans, the Palace Museum provides a glimpse into royal life during the 19th century.
  • Highlights: Explore historical artifacts, traditional furniture, photographs, and portraits that tell the story of Zanzibar’s monarchy.
  • Photography Opportunities: The beautifully restored rooms and exhibits offer great backdrops for cultural photography.

2. The Peace Memorial Museum

  • Why Visit: Dedicated to Zanzibar’s modern history and path to independence, this museum provides context about social, political, and historical events that shaped the island.
  • Highlights: Learn about colonial rule, post-independence struggles, and cultural transitions through informative exhibits.
  • Ideal For: History enthusiasts seeking a deeper understanding of Zanzibar beyond its beaches.

3. The Palace of Wonders (Beit-el-Ajaib)

  • Why Visit: As the largest building in East Africa, the House of Wonders showcases Zanzibar’s scientific, technological, and cultural history.
  • Highlights: Exhibits include Swahili culture, maritime history, astronomy, and traditional crafts.
  • Cultural Significance: A hub for educational and cultural events, giving visitors an interactive experience of Zanzibari heritage.

4. Dhow Yachting Cultural Village Tours

  • Why Visit: Learn about Zanzibar’s traditional dhow-building techniques, maritime trade history, and fishing culture.
  • Highlights: Visit coastal villages where artisans construct traditional wooden dhows and explore their role in Swahili trade networks.
  • Experience: Participate in interactive sessions or guided demonstrations, perfect for hands-on cultural exploration.

5. Forodhani Gardens and Night Market

  • Why Visit: While primarily a food destination, Forodhani Gardens offers a cultural feast for the senses.
  • Highlights: Sample local dishes like Zanzibar pizza, sugarcane juice, and seafood delicacies, while observing traditional cooking methods.
  • Cultural Value: The market reflects Zanzibar’s multicultural identity, blending Arab, Indian, and African culinary traditions.

6. Kidichi Persian Baths & Stone Town Heritage Walks

  • Why Visit: The Kidichi Persian Baths offer insight into 19th-century leisure and architectural styles.
  • Highlights: Guided heritage walks through Stone Town complement the baths visit, showcasing ancient mosques, markets, and Swahili mansions.
  • Photography Opportunities: Capture ornate doors, narrow alleys, and historical facades, perfect for cultural storytelling.

Tips for Visiting Cultural Centers

  • Hire a Local Guide: Guides provide context, stories, and insider knowledge you might miss otherwise.
  • Respect Local Customs: Dress modestly and seek permission before photographing people or religious sites.
  • Plan Timing: Mornings and early afternoons are ideal to avoid crowds and enjoy comfortable temperatures.
  • Combine Experiences: Pair cultural center visits with spice farm tours, dhow trips, or local workshops for a comprehensive cultural immersion.
